Manager - Government & Institutional Relations - Power & Energy

10 - 15 Years.Delhi NCR
Posted 4 years ago
Posted 4 years ago

Ensure compliance with external regulatory requirements and implementation of relevant internal company policies and procedures and represent PG in such matters before regulatory bodies. Be the recognized expert on Public Affairs issues (government relations, business institutions, social institutions and academia) and serve as the country's primary Government & Institutional Relations contact for the business. Drive and execute actions aligned with the business strategy.

1. Strategic & operational service delivery

- Develops, defines and executes the Government & Institutional Relations strategy in the country, in alignment with the global Government & Institutional Relations, to support the business strategy in the local organization. Ensures service standards are defined and the appropriate processes are developed and delivered to meet the agreed service levels and provide business continuity.

- Helps develop a greater awareness of Government & Institutional Relations- contribution to business volume and profitability.

- Closely collaborates with the Country MD / LSM to identify and support business development opportunities by driving advocacy and arranging discussions with senior level government officials as well as other political, business, institutional and academic stakeholders.

- Helps arrange and coordinate high-level meetings, visits and events, and prepares related documents both required by the governments and the company internally, including but not limited to government economic KPIs, government organization charts and personnel information, local development strategies, as well as PG's presence and performance in the country etc. Supports crisis and issues management relevant to the geography.

2. External relationships

- Establishes and maintains positive direct relationships at all levels of government bodies and officials (ministries, bureaucrats, diplomats, government agencies), quasi-governmental agencies, public services and other authorities (federal, state, provincial, city) to facilitate communication and help advance the organization's business interests. Manages the organization's high level, complex, controversial or critical government relationships.

- Engages with regional and local business institutions (forums, trade and industry associations, technical bodies, multilateral banks & funding agencies, state owned utilities, joint ventures and alliances) as well as industry analysts and other influential key opinion leaders relevant to the country's market, presenting perspective on critical industry topics.

- Builds relationships within the country's key social institutions, NGOs, environmental bodies as well as academia, providing input and building brand equity in this area.

3. External representation

- Represents company's position on legislation and government policy to national government representatives, regulators, committees, chambers, business and trade associations, non-governmental entities and academia to position PG as a trusted partner and increase the company's influence in those organizations.

- Promotes brand, products and service to all levels of Government & Institutional Relations stakeholders.

- Identifies funding streams to support business development projects and advocates for favourable spectrum and regulatory policies.

4. Analysis

- Monitors, analyses and interprets developments in legislative, regulatory, political and economic environment and advises senior management on how these trends may impact the organization's business interests.

- Assesses and provides legislative and regulatory solutions. Monitors, assesses, and summarizes legislation that could impact key business lines.

- Manages the submission of periodic data from the country to the global Government & Institutional Relations team.

- Presents updates to executive leadership on key Government & Institutional Relations topics within the country.

Desired Profile :

- 10-15 years-experience in government/business/institutional relations or closely related leading corporate or public functions, preferably within power grids or the power or energy sector. Experience both inside and outside of governments, business and trade associations is a plus.

- Deep understanding of political, regulatory and business processes in power grids business or the energy sector in India

- Strong experience with government relations, public affairs, business institutions, trade associations, social institutions and academia

- Strong experience with agenda-setting and policy issues

- Track record of success in building strong relationships in a highly matrixed, fast paced

- Environment with changing priorities
